being new I did not know we could do missions together in that way and if I killed something for my brother who didn't own the specific weapon it could count for him. I do see where health of the game financially is a concern here. However, limiting the rental time of the weapon would negate it. I do see where the missions are also an incentive to invest in the game and that I didn't know I could assist with my armory may have made my commentary come off a bit off base. I believe in supporting a game i love that provides good clear content. Whether that in the form of subscription or cash shop items to a degree that the cash shop does not put me on a higher playing field or pay to win scenario which this game does not. Thank you for the insight into missions. i can help my friends and brother i have invited to the game.

Re: hard to earn Gm$ these day's
Weapon rental, even if they decided they wanted to go down that route, would not be as straight forward to implement as just temporarily assigning a weapon to that player's inventory. They would have to disable skill progression for that weapon, as well as rank and achievement contributions. They would also need to avoid the function that automatically assigns 3 boxes of ammo and sets it to replenish. So, whilst possible, there would be a number of things to take into consideration. All somewhat moot though, since I very much doubt it will ever happen.
